Three Arrested for Drug Trafficking in Balkh Province

The Balkh Police Command, affiliated with the Taliban administration, announced the arrest of three individuals on charges of buying and selling narcotics in Mazar-i-Sharif city and Balkh district. These individuals were identified and detained following a security operation.

According to a statement issued by the police command, 300 grams of pregabalin, 19 tablets known as “Ka,” and 35 grams of methamphetamine were seized from the detainees.

Officials added that the cases of these individuals will be referred to judicial and legal authorities for further legal proceedings and sentencing after initial investigations are completed.

Balkh province is considered one of the important regions in northern Afghanistan, and there have been previous reports of drug discoveries and seizures in various parts of the province.
